Strange Dash Lights

Three weeks ago, when I turned on my 2003 MINI Cooper S, the DSC off light and the flat tire light came on. The tires weren't flat, and pushing the re-set button did nothing. I got frustrated and took another car to work. Later, when I started the MINI again, the lights came on, but shut off as soon as I began to reverse the car.

Then, the lights came on again today. At a stop light I shut the car off, then turned it back on, and as I drove off the light switched off again.

The DSC is working normally, and I don't have a flat tire. The manual says that if the DSC light stays on, it means you have a problem with the DSC--but it seems to be working fine. And I do not have a flat tire. The manual does not say what these lights mean if they are on at the same time, and I am even more confused by the fact that re-starting the car will cause these lights to shut off for indeterminant amounts of time.

My MINI dealer has suggested it may be a faulty wheel speed sensor--but if it is actually broken, shouldn't the lights stay on? Could this possibly be an electrical problem? Has anyone seen anything like this? Does anyone have any ideas?
